Markets, cafes, and neighborhood streets within reach.
Liyang puts you close to the Liyang Museum, local dining, and easy errands downtown, with things to do in Liyang within a short walk from your stay.
Liyang Museum
A compact stop for local history and tea culture, useful when you want a quiet break between meals and errands.
Yanshan Park
A central green space with paved paths and open seating, easy to reach when you want a slower hour outside.
Tianmu Lake
Known for long waterfront walks and lake views, it is an easy half day if you want fresh air nearby.
Nanshan Bamboo Sea
Bamboo-covered hills and shaded trails make this a practical day trip for travelers who want scenery beyond the city center.
